Be Aware of European Consumer Rights if applicable:
- Since the website is based in Europe, it would be subject to EU consumer protection laws, such as the EU Consumer Rights Directive. This directive often grants consumers a 14-day “cooling-off period” during which they can cancel an online purchase for any reason, even after receiving the goods.
- However, applying these rights directly to a US customer purchasing from an EU site can be complex, especially concerning international shipping costs for returns. While the right to withdraw exists, the cost and logistics of returning a large item across continents might be significant and borne by the customer.

- EU Consumer Rights Context: As an EU-based company, Elios-cover.com would generally be subject to EU consumer protection laws. The EU Consumer Rights Directive grants consumers a 14-day “right of withdrawal” from distance contracts online purchases, allowing them to return goods within this period without needing to provide a reason.
- Practicality for US Customers: While this right exists, the practical implications for a US customer are significant:
- Return Shipping Costs: Typically, for a change of mind return under EU law, the consumer is responsible for the return shipping costs. For large, heavy items shipped internationally, this could be extremely expensive.
- Customs and Duties on Returns: The process for returning goods across international borders can involve customs declarations and may incur additional fees.
- Refund Processing: Refunds would be processed in Euros, and the US customer would receive the equivalent in USD, subject to exchange rates at the time of refund, which could result in a slight loss if the exchange rate changes unfavorably.
